1964 Volkswagen Beetle Convertible



This car is a beauty as it is finished in professionally applied PPG Ruby Red paint inside and out with a Sewfine white vinyl interior. The sedan has been converted to 8 volts for reliability and has a rebuilt 1967 transmission. All mechanical systems were new or replaced. Nothing has been done to the car to prevent changing it back to a stock 40 HP engine or 6 volts. It was fully restored body off in 2004 by D&B Restoration, a long time custom body shop here in NW Arkansas. No body filler was used. I am a retired VWoA Volkswagen dealership technician from the 1970's. No rust or dents anywhere. Always garaged since restoration. Paint is great and could use a few very minor touch ups. Here is your chance to own a classic VW at an affordable price!  I bought this VW from a local Doctor who had the car restored in 2004.

It has been completely restored. Wolfsburg West parts were used during the restoration.  Multiple Volkswagen Show 1st Place and Best of Show  winner. You can be ready for the upcoming VW Show season with only a wash and wax job! Or have a perfect daily driver. Original stock configuration except for rebuilt 1348cc engine and 1967 transaxle. It also has a period correct complete Judson Supercharger! Drives 65-70 without a problem.  A nice, tight VW that you could drive anywhere. The heater and defroster works great. The Speedometer/Trip Odometer was refurbished and reset to 0 miles.

It does need a new headliner or repaired. There is is rip above the rear window and the headliner is dirty, look at the pictures to see the problem. It was like that when I bought the car. I am including new headliner material that can be use to patch or make a new panel to repair it.

It also has a couple of minor electrical gremlins. Sometimes the horn will work and the backup light doesn’t work every time. And I think the fog light switch might be bad. It has a Sun tachometer mounted to the lower left of the steering wheel, but needs a sending unit.

Volkswagen Golf R Evo may debut at Beijing Motor Show

Thu, 23 Jan 2014

If a report in Auto Express is correct, a lighter, faster brother to the Volkswagen Golf R will be shown to the world at the Beijing Motor Show in April. Said to be called the Golf R Evo, the even harder hot hatch would be unveiled as one of those concepts that's practically a de facto presentation of the genuine thing. The Evo in its name will come from having a carbon fiber roof and CF in the bodywork, lighter wheels, thinner bucket seats up front and a roll cage instead of rear seats.
If there's a power increase, it's been described as "a small bump." However, as the report mentions, if the Jenny Craig regimen can drop 100 kilograms (220 pounds) from the the 3,247-pound weight of the European Golf R, then the Golf R Evo will do about the same damage on the scales as the Golf but have at least 50 more horsepower and 44 more pound-feet of torque.
Since we still don't have the current Golf, this isn't something that should keep you awake even if the 'concept' does become a production model. But it is good to know that the Golf R is really going to start pushing its boundaries.

Volkswagen considering a four-door, four-seat XL1

Fri, 22 Aug 2014

According to a report in Autocar, Volkswagen might have more in mind for the XL1 than mining it for advances to grace the next-generation Golf. Aiming to fight the Honda FCEV due for public consumption next year, we're told VW executives have put a four-door, four-seater version of the XL1 - it could be called XL2 - on the drawing board. The impetus is said to come from the top, with VW Group chairman Ferdinand Piëch intent on staying in the deep end of "super-efficent vehicles."
Autocar suspects the necessary changes could raise the weight of the car from 1,749 pounds to 2,068 pounds, which would make it four pounds less than the 2,072-pound Up! we drove a few years ago. Crucially, however, the mag thinks the extra capacity wouldn't change the two-seater's 310-mile-per-gallon rating, with tech tweaks and the aerodynamic benefit of a longer car offsetting the weight. Speculation is that the back seats would be staggered like the fronts in order to maintain the XL1's overall profile.
We recently heard about another XL1 variant that's gone off the radar entirely, the Ducati-engined XLR that we thought we'd see at the Geneva Motor Show and that was said to be going into production, so this one could go the same way. The biggest hurdle to making such an idea a reality, though, could be the price: the current XL1 costs 110,000 euros ($146,116). If VW really is going to compete with the Honda FCEV and the Toyota FCV - $70,000 in Japan - that might be where it wants to start.

VW Golf Sportsvan succeeds Golf Plus in Frankfurt

Sun, 08 Sep 2013


Just ahead of this week's Frankfurt Motor Show, Volkswagen has announced the world premiere of its Golf Sportsvan, a near-production concept that succeeds its Golf Plus. VW describes this compact family car as "one of the most versatile vehicles of the compact class," noting that it offers a mix of hatchback and minivan features in a sporty package.
That sportiness comes from the Sportsvan's styling (perhaps more sleek wagon than minivan) and performance features it shares with the Golf GTI - including the XDS+ electronic differential lock, which is integrated into the Electronic Stability Control system to improve agility. At the same time, the Sportsvan's six engine options, which include a turbodiesel, are up to 19-percent more fuel-efficient than their predecessors.
